  2. Depends upon your bag size on the volcano! I was using their original bags they came with but they are kinda chinsy, get little air holes in it after awhile. I use Reynolds wrap oven safe bags (original used for cooking chickens, turkeys, etc.). I get about 3-4 deep breathed inhales out of the chicken sized bag, and roughly about 3-4 solid bags when I pack .3 gram in it. When I say Solid it means you can't see anything threw the bag. Then it starts to thin out from there on. Volcanos very versatile as well, when I have more then 3 people in rotation I switch to the turkey sized bag and I can get about 10 deep breathes out of it. I have the analog Volcano, only downside to it is you have to watch the light on it when you are blowing the bag up. Usually takes 2 light phases to blow up the personal bag. My buddy has the digital volcano and he can blow up pretty much any size bag without having to worry about the temp going down. Just gotta make sure to stir up what you packed after each bag. I would recommend the digital, it really is nice being able to find out which temp works best with each strain, some strains just don't taste good at the temp you ran before. You don't have to worry about it combusting, definitely no way possible. I've run it full blast and it didn't combust. Just hurts to hit when temps to high.

  12. #12 lwien, Sep 27, 2014
    Last edited by a moderator: Sep 27, 2014
     
    Downsides to the Volcano:
     
    One of the least efficient vapes on the market.
    LOTS of internal surface area in that bag for condensation to take place.   Not a good thing.
    Vapor begins to go stale as soon as it enters the bag.    Starts tasting pretty nasty after about 10 minutes.
    Unlike glass or ceramic, all plastic will add a taste of it's own to the herbs, including the plastic bags of the 'Cano.
    Noisy when in operation.
    You cannot leave it out without people going, "What in the hell is that?"  That is, not very stealthy.
    At any given temperature, the Volcano will have a higher air to vapor ratio than other vapes that use a different delivery system.   In other words, the vapor is not as dense.   The only way to get dense vapor with a Volcano is to put a lot of weed in the crucible and crank up the heat, which negatively affects both the taste and the efficiency.
     
    But...........if you are primarily going to use your vape as a party vape, nothing beats the idiot-proofness of a bag.

  18.  
    If you primarily want that, do NOT get the Volcano.    You would be MUCH better off getting a log vape, such as the E-Nano, the Hi or the Underdog all of which are very efficient vaporizers.     When I went from a Volcano to my Purple Days (log vape that is no longer being made), my consumption was cut down by more than half.
